This invention relates to an information processing apparatus for
permitting so-called grouping without recourse to group keys. A content
server retains in advance certificates of devices subject to grouping.
Each certificate contains a public key of the corresponding device. When
providing a content, the content server authenticates the certificates of
the grouped devices for which the content is destined (step S281),
encrypts a content key by use of public keys of the authenticated
certificates (step S283), and transmits the content key thus encrypted to
each of the devices making up the group (step S284) together with the
content. The inventive apparatus is applied to devices that provide
contents.